I've decided to open up a thread for games by Kemco in general, due to the announcement of Kemco RPG Selection Vol. 1, a collection game for PlayStation 4 that contains Asdivine Hearts, Revenant Saga, Antiquia Lost, and Dragon Sinker.

Anyways, what do you guys think of their games? Also, which are your favorites and why?
